For nine years (1943-1952) listeners were invited to ride a passenger train in the company of a mysterious stranger (Maurice Tarplin), who always had a dark and uncanny tale for a willing ear. Mysterious Traveler was popular enough to engender two 'spin-off' series-- The Sealed Book and The Strange Dr. Weird. Both spin-offs produced no originals, only remakes of MT stories. Sealed Book tended to deal with murder as its primary subject, while Dr. Weird (also hosted by Tarplin) leaned more toward the macabre. The Mysterious Traveler boasted about 400 episodes of which, sadly, only about 71 have survived. That being the case, I have decided only to list the shows known to still exist.
